SelectionTypes Sabit listesi

Tanım

Bir seçimin türünü gösteren tanımlayıcıları tanımlar.

Bu sabit listesi, üyeleri için bit düzeyinde karşılaştırmayı destekler.

public enum class SelectionTypes
[System.Flags]
public enum SelectionTypes
[System.Flags]
[System.Runtime.InteropServices.ComVisible(true)]
public enum SelectionTypes
[<System.Flags>]
type SelectionTypes = 
[<System.Flags>]
[<System.Runtime.InteropServices.ComVisible(true)>]
type SelectionTypes = 
Public Enum SelectionTypes
Devralma
SelectionTypes
Öznitelikler

Alanlar

Add 64

Seçili bileşenleri geçerli seçime ekleyen ve geçerli seçili bileşen kümesini koruyan bir ekleme seçimini temsil eder.

Auto 1

Normal bir seçimi temsil eder. Seçim hizmeti, seçime veya seçimden bileşen eklemeyi veya kaldırmayı desteklemek için CTRL ve SHIFT tuşlarına yanıt verir.

Click 16

Kullanıcı bir bileşene tıkladığında oluşan bir seçimi temsil eder. Yeni seçilen bileşen zaten seçiliyse, iptal etmek yerine birincil seçilen bileşen olarak yükseltilir.

MouseDown 4

Kullanıcı fare işaretçisi bir bileşenin üzerindeyken fare düğmesine bastığında oluşan bir seçimi temsil eder. İşaretçinin altındaki bileşen zaten seçiliyse, iptal etmek yerine birincil seçilen bileşen olacak şekilde yükseltilir.

MouseUp 8

Kullanıcı, bir bileşen seçildikten hemen sonra fare düğmesini serbest bıraktığında oluşan bir seçimi temsil eder. Yeni seçilen bileşen zaten seçiliyse, iptal etmek yerine birincil seçilen bileşen olarak yükseltilir.

Normal 1

Normal bir seçimi temsil eder. Seçim hizmeti, seçime veya seçimden bileşen eklemeyi veya kaldırmayı desteklemek için CTRL ve SHIFT tuşlarına yanıt verir.

Primary 16

Kullanıcı bir bileşene tıkladığında oluşan birincil seçimi temsil eder. Seçim listesindeki bir bileşen zaten seçiliyse, bileşen birincil seçim olarak yükseltilir.

Remove 128

Seçili bileşenleri geçerli seçimden kaldıran ve geçerli seçili bileşen kümesini koruyan bir kaldırma seçimini temsil eder.

Replace 2

Bir seçimin içeriği değiştirildiğinde oluşan bir seçimi temsil eder. Seçim hizmeti, geçerli seçimi değiştirme ile değiştirir.

Toggle 32

Geçerli seçim ile sağlanan seçim arasında geçiş yapılan iki durumlu seçimi temsil eder. Bir bileşen zaten seçiliyse ve seçim türüyle TogglegeçirilirseSetSelectedComponents, bileşen seçimi iptal edilir.

Valid 31

Geçerli seçim türlerini , , Replace, MouseDownMouseUpveya Clickolarak Normaltanımlar.

Açıklamalar

Tasarımcı belgesinin bileşenleri, yöntemi ISelectionServicekullanılarak SetSelectedComponents seçilebilir. Bazı eylem türleri, seçilen bir bileşen veya seçili bileşen grubu üzerinde çalışabilir. geçerli ISelectionService seçimin seçim türünü izler. Bu seçim türü tanımlayıcıları, seçimin tek tıklamayla mı, fare aşağı mı yoksa fare yukarı seçimiyle mi tamamlandığını, seçimin önceki seçimi mi değiştirdiğini yoksa varsayılan seçim modunu mu kullandığını gösterir.

SelectionTypes yöntemini kullanarak yeni bir seçim ayarlarken seçim türünü belirtmek için numaralandırmayı SetSelectedComponents kullanın.

Şunlara uygulanır

Ayrıca bkz.